Item Details

  • Exceptional grip performance and fully coated protection in a comfortable ultralight weight cut resistant glove. The 11-539 epitomizes the convergence of protection and performance. It features an 18G ultralight weight liner with INTERCEPT™ Technology yarns that provides EN Cut Level 2 protection. The liner also features ZONZ™ Comfort Fit Technology for breathability and ergonomic movement. The fully dipped coating and the FORTIX™ Technology formulation provide enhanced abrasion resistance and grip. To provide all four advanced performance technologies including EN Level 2 cut protection in a comfortable flexible ultralight weight style is a game changer for applications where workers have traditionally guarded against cut risks with heavier styles that limit their dexterity and breathability.

Features

  • Bare hand-like Tactility- Ultralight weight glove that offers unparalleled dexterity and refined mobility
  • Comfort Fit Technology- ZONZ™ knitting technology uses selected yarns and varying stitch designs to tailor overall glove fit to enhance hand movement for higher dexterity and reduced fatigue
  • Silicone free design is paint and finish process friendly
  • Dirt-Masking Color- Dirt masking palm for longer wear times

Applications

  • Assembly of small parts
  • Light duties
  • Handling smooth, slippery or sharp-edged materials like glass, sheet metal, tile and veneer
  • Maintenance

Specifications

  • EN388 4342
  • ANSI 4 Abrasion
  • ANSI 2 Cut
